Type
ORACLE
Validation date
2023-09-24 15:29: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03853,
    "usd": 0.04159
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001493A5B6030C752B421C4A9F27862C5DA7929F34C61730E9E675C85C1250F611E

Previous signature

7090961EAF47D97BAAB8C72D5C34F8F47F62C8C8965B01E3667A3832DE35A55D5CAC6814D0E1C1DC8365B6B08D3952C5A2128FB7684789BE853354CA4FE5FE05

Origin signature

3046022100BEAAEF24D85427A206CF2495EEFD555223C50B9AE562F4153B7E20F1FC61547D022100999F8D04DF7388A3F90AF6A47112C48E7C20F4574C1EB1CF817DA5C2D9828BC9

Proof of work

010104F42E0529CBE4D86A4743F2029D6EAD3EA87352F3157CFF15DB15FBB5930704AD0134FE5B45310D1A7C625504B3B647E3C9298099E0BB9A97C608C93FD8BF2B9C

Proof of integrity

008477A7E8D4451AE7679693A697B0BB3F38B69ED1261913AF5FE9F8B9698D7C06

Coordinator signature

A62BA6F1ABDB949AF22298F1780BE319630799ED99332EDDEB8549ECD86B10CBE984E51BDD59BFE51D3F9517D3FBD134114B1AA8206EFC4AAA5B3A5BE160D10C

Validator #1 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#1 signature

C5ED9314B0D0AAD1EBD667CAE732C7D1000188200FAD73DE94A73DC59106A41026D23DC0AD0D89A3B3115694DB1539485DA5A2FE491C310837CB6397FCA5B603

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

5EBBF3A1F549FC87FBA465B02844F31BC954BFCE042D567A52EEA4C9F5445401F852A16587D41D9E9C3E21D37CEE811E54131B2FEA76B5504FA0965E59F14106